the time card management feature lets users track the time they work on time sheets and create time cards to report it it also lets managers review and approve the time cards first let's look at the default timesheet policies under project Administration settings we're logged in as itpps admin role you can create many time policies to support your organization's diverse time management workflow processes even for individual users including how time cards are generated approved and routed you can also check the project state of each time card which tracks time card activity let's check the project preferences to see what level of time reporting is allowed we'll choose project and project tasks let's add an employee to the new project task great Joe is all set to enter the time he works now we're logged in as Joe let's record time for the task we're assigned to start we navigate to the timesheet portal it opens in a new browser tab in the project task We'll add four hours for each day of the work week and in the other tab We'll add the one hour team meeting from Tuesday we'll double check the time we entered before we submit the timesheet once we submit it'll be locked everything looks good so we submit the timesheet for approval going forward it may be easier to copy a previous week's timesheet and edit it for the current week now we're logged in as the project manager and we need to approve Joe's time card we'll find Joe's time cards choose the one for the current period and approve finally let's see how the approved time card is reflected in the project foreign card is processed and an expense line was automatically created from the time card we can see the amount of the expense the state of the expense is pending until someone in finance approves it for more information see our product documentation or knowledge base or ask a question in the servicenow community
